Skip to content
配图

系统设计短文收藏

X 上系统设计内容多为压缩版博文。阅读方式应是「提取模型」,而非背答案。

常见模型卡片

1. 读写分离 + 缓存

  • 读多写少 → CDN / Redis
  • 一致性:TTL + 失效策略写清楚

2. 限流与背压

  • 令牌桶保护下游
  • 队列满时降级而非拖死全站

3. ID 与分片

  • 雪花 ID vs UUID 的权衡帖常被引用
  • 分片键避免热点用户

4. 事件驱动

  • 至少一次投递 + 幂等消费者
  • 死信队列处理 poison message

如何读一条设计帖

  1. 画出数据流(3 个框足够)
  2. 标出单点故障
  3. 问「10 倍流量哪里先挂」

社区批评的「玩具设计」

高赞反驳帖指出:脱离 SLA 与成本的设计答案.score 很高但不可落地。收藏时注明:你的 QPS、预算、团队人数

延伸书单(帖中反复提及)

  • 《Designing Data-Intensive Applications》
  • 各云厂商 Well-Architected 框架

把 X 当索引,把书与官方文档当正文——这是资深工程师在帖里隐藏的潜台词。

Visitors · Page views